Pituitary Cancer: Early Symptoms, Visual Disturbances, and Sellar MRI Detection

Pituitary cancer is a rare but clinically significant pathology due to its critical location and potential to cause substantial systemic disturbances. One of the most common manifestations of pituitary tumors is visual disturbances, which may include visual field defects, loss of vision, and diplopia. Early detection of these neoplasms is crucial for improving clinical outcomes and minimizing complications. In this context, sellar magnetic resonance imaging emerges as an essential diagnostic tool for the early identification of these lesions.
Diving Deeper into Pituitary Cancer and Its Manifestations
Although pituitary tumors are generally benign, they can present severe complications due to their proximity to the optic chiasm and other critical structures. Visual disturbances are often the first warning sign that leads patients to seek medical attention. Studies have shown that pituitary apoplexy can present with acute neurological and ophthalmological symptoms, requiring rapid and accurate diagnosis to prevent permanent sequelae [1].
Hyperprolactinemia is another common manifestation of pituitary adenomas, especially in prolactinomas, which can cause significant endocrine dysfunctions. The Foster-Kennedy syndrome is a rare but documented phenomenon in the context of pituitary adenomas, where optic atrophy is observed in one eye and papilledema in the other, highlighting the complexity of clinical presentations [2].
Sellar magnetic resonance imaging is the method of choice for evaluating the sellar region. This advanced imaging technique allows for detailed visualization of the pituitary gland and surrounding structures, facilitating the detection of early symptoms and the planning of appropriate therapeutic interventions. A multicenter study on pituitary abscesses underscores the importance of MRI in the differential diagnosis of sellar lesions [3].
